I will never think that I have a perfect short film because there are some errors in the film breaking the flow on continuity. As i lost part of my footage due to having a broken SD Card, i had to film some of the scenes again. The actor work the same costume but forgot about the hairband on her wrist. It isn't majorly noticeable but i know it is there. In the future, i will make sure that i look very carefully at the actor and what she is wearing before reshooting. Not sticking to my contingency plan was one of my biggest mistakes as it caused to have have to waste time in re-filming some of my film. This caused me to waste a lot of valuable editing time. In the future i will make sure that i save all my footage and sound recordings in more than one place so that if the SD card does break again or even get lost, i will still have the footage i have shot.
